Numerical analysis of vertical double gate mosfets (VDGM) with dielectric pocket (DP) effects on silicon pillar for nanoscale transistor
Numerical analysis of vertical double-gate MOSFETs (VDGM) that incorporates dielectric-pocket (DP) is addressed in this paper for the suppression of short-channel effects (SCE) and bulk punch-through.
